#d4f579 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4f579 is composed of 83.1% red, 96.1%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.6%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 76 degrees, a saturation of 86.1% and a lightness of 71.8%. #d4f579 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ff2 with #a9eb00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

Shades and Tints of #d4f579
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090c01 is the darkest color, while #fdfff9 is the lightest one.
